NET Software Engineer Senior

2 months ago


Bucharest, Bucureşti, Romania Worldpay Full time
Are you ready to write your next chapter?

Make your mark at one of the biggest names in payments. With proven technology, we process the largest volume of payments in the world, driving the global economy every day.

When you join Worldpay, you join a global community of experts and changemakers, working to reinvent an industry by constantly evolving how we work and making the way millions of people pay easier, every day.

What makes a Worldpayer? It's simple: Think, Act, Win.

We stay curious, always asking the right questions to be better every day, finding creative solutions to simplify the complex.

We're dynamic, every Worldpayer is empowered to make the right decisions for their customers. And we're determined, always staying open – winning and failing as one.


We're looking for a .NET Software Engineer Senior to join our evolving WPAP team to help us unleash the potential of every business.

Are you ready to make your mark? Then you sound like a Worldpayer.

About the team

Our Product and Technology teams are the Worldpayers behind the game-changing products and digital experiences we're best known for. Striving for better, they never stand still — delivering impactful innovations that power transactions across the world.


Worldpay's Alternative Payments Department specialise in delivering online payment services to our customers and are looking for Engineers to join our team to take it to the next level.


Operating within a collaborative Scrum environment, we aim to deliver effective solutions to the business and our customers using our evolving payment platform.

What you'll own

Produce well structured, maintainable, reliable and fit for purpose code at an accepted level of quality

Develop unit tests to the highest possible coverage levels

Produce system requirements and estimates from business requirements

Proactively identifying and suggesting improvements and enhancements to working practices

Demonstrate a can-do attitude and a sense of responsibility for the wider implications of software engineering

Demonstrate a flexible approach necessary for the role as business requirements and their relative priorities are subject to review and change

Provide assistance to QA Engineers and Support Teams as required

Development of new applications, analyses of current applications and processes, and making recommendations

Support Agile and technical agility (e.g. participation in meetings, keeps tracking tools up to date, visibility provided to manager and stakeholders)

What you bring

Proven experience and/or a genuine passion for software development.

Degree level education (in related subject of computing, maths, science) or equivalent.

Knowledge/practical application of agile methodologies.

Strong C# and .NET Core knowledge

Knowledge of:
Restful

Microsoft SQL Server, T-SQL

Unit Testing

Continuous Integration

Continuous Delivery

SOLID Principles

Track record in delivering work to schedule and to specification

Experience of object-oriented design

Experience of database design on Enterprise scale database systems

Knowledge of web application security

Added bonus if you have:
Kubernetes

Micro Service Architecture

Docker

DevOps

Jenkins

Cloud AWS

Software Design Patterns

Message Queues

Worldpay perks - what we'll bring for you

We know it's bigger than just your career. It's your life, and your world. That's why we offer global benefits and programs to support you at every stage. Here's a taste of what you can expect.

A competitive salary and benefits.

Time to support charities and give back to your community.

Parental leave policy.

Global recognition platform.

Virgin Pulse access.

Global employee assistance program.

What makes a Worldpayer

At Worldpay, we take our Values seriously, and we live them every day. Think like a customer, Act like an owner, and Win as a team.

Empowered. Accountable. Dynamic. We stay agile, using our initiative, taking calculated risks to progress. Never standing still, never settling, we work at pace to achieve our goals. We champion our ideas and stay flexible to make them happen. We know that every action adds up.

Does this sound like you? Then you sound like a Worldpayer.

Apply now to write the next chapter in your career. We can't wait to hear from you.

To find out more about working with us, find us on LinkedIn.

  • Bucharest, Bucureşti, Romania Microsoft Games Full time

    Microsoft is on a mission to empower every person and every organization on the planet to achieve more. Our culture is centered on embracing a growth mindset, a theme of inspiring excellence, and encouraging teams and leaders to bring their best each day. The Commerce + Ecosystems (C+E) division is developing Microsoft's large scale and business-critical...


  • Bucharest, Bucureşti, Romania Talentor Romania Full time

    Senior Software Engineer Our client, a leading financial institution, is seeking a highly skilled Senior Software Engineer to join their team. As a key member of the development team, you will be responsible for designing and developing large-scale systems to handle massive data transfers and performing complex calculations based on business needs. ...


  • Bucharest, Bucureşti, Romania Electronic Arts Full time

    EA SPORTS is one of the most iconic brands in entertainment with over 25 years of innovation, passion, and connection of millions of players across the globe to their favorite sports, teams, and players. At the heart of EA SPORTS is the EA SPORTSTM FC franchise. EA SPORTSTM FC is the world's #1 best-selling video game with over 200M engaged players across...

  • Software Engineer

    4 weeks ago


    Bucharest, Bucureşti, Romania JT International S.A. Full time

    At JTI we celebrate differences, and everyone truly belongs. 46,000 people from all over the world are continuously building their unique success story with us. 83% of employees feel happy working at JTI. To make a difference with us, all you need to do is bring your human best. What will your story be? Apply now Learn more: Software Engineer What this...

  • Software Engineer

    2 months ago


    Bucharest, Bucureşti, Romania Randstad Digital Romania Full time

    Position overviewWe are looking for a 2 Software Engineers (Configuration Tools) to join our Randstad Digital Romanian Team in a new challenging project in automotive field.In this role, you will develop the software tools meant to make configuration of drivers or other applications running on top of our client processors, simple, intuitive, reliable, and...


  • Bucharest, Bucureşti, Romania AMANO EUROPE NV, Genk - Bucharest Branch Full time

    NET Software developer/C#Amano is looking for a dynamic software developer to join our team. If you have good C#, Web and SQL knowledge and you want to envision together with us our complex products, then we'd love you to join our team.We develop our Amano products on Parking business where the creativity and implication from you is much appreciated. All...

  • Software Engineer

    1 month ago


    Bucharest, Bucureşti, Romania Booking Holdings Romania Full time

    Booking Holdings Romania is a Center of Excellence based in Bucharest, Romania and was created to support the increasing business demands of the Booking Holdings Brands. The Center of Excellence provides access to specialized and highly skilled talent, leading industry best practices, and collaboration opportunities across all of our Brands.As part of our...


  • Bucharest, Bucureşti, Romania RINA Full time

    RINA is currently recruiting for a Senior Electrical Engineer - Power to join its office in Romania within the Green Energy Solutions Division.MissionThis role focuses on executing consultancy on as well as engineering and design of MV/HV electrical systems concerning power generation and industrial facilities grid connection.Key AccountabilitiesKey...


  • Bucharest, Bucureşti, Romania Randstad Digital Romania Full time

    Project overviewWe are looking for an Embedded Software Engineer to join our Randstad team in a challenging project in Bucharest - Grozavesti area (hybrid work model). Within this project, you will have the opportunity to contribute to development, unit test and maintenance activities on various applications. Also, under the responsibility of a project...


  • Bucharest, Bucureşti, Romania Enereco S.p.A. Full time

    About the JobWhat we are looking for?We are looking for several Instrumentation and Control (Engineer or Senior or Junior, see the requirements hereunder) to join our team in Bucharest (Romania), that will be responsible in managing Instrumentation aspects of small projects or to work in teams in the Oil & Gas Industry.If you'd like to grow and learn with us...


  • Bucharest, Bucureşti, Romania SODA Full time

    **Senior DevOps Engineer (AWS Cloud Practitioner)** **About the Company:** Our client is a fast-growing B2C digital marketplace scale-up, at the forefront of innovation and digital transformation. **Job Summary:** We are seeking a talented Senior DevOps Engineer with AWS Cloud Practitioner expertise to join our dynamic team. As a key member of our technical...

  • Software Engineer

    1 month ago


    Bucharest, Bucureşti, Romania Booking Holdings Romania Full time

    Booking Holdings Romania is a Center of Excellence based in Bucharest, Romania and was created to support the increasing business demands of the Booking Holdings Brands. The Center of Excellence provides access to specialized and highly skilled talent, leading industry best practices, and collaboration opportunities across all of our Brands.As part of our...


  • Bucharest, Bucureşti, Romania Adobe Full time

    JOB LEVELP40ADDITIONAL JOB LEVELSP30-EMPLOYEE ROLEIndividual ContributorThe OpportunityAdobe GenStudio is a generative AI-first product that lets marketing teams quickly plan, build, handle, activate and measure on-brand content. It allows any team member to quickly find and generate assets, create variations, and optimize experiences based on real-time...

  • senior qa engineer

    2 months ago


    Bucharest, Bucureşti, Romania SoftNet Group Full time

    SENIOR QA ENGINEERSummaryQA role in a new team at an established international company of more than 20 years that is now in scaleup modeResponsible for QA process including building automated regression testing and hands-on testing where automated testing still to be implementedThere is an opportunity to combine this with a DevOps role if candidate has...


  • Bucharest, Bucureşti, Romania HUAWEI TECHNOLOGIES Full time

    Front Office Software Engineer (Bucharest)New ideas are all around us, but only a few will change the world. Are you a change maker interested to be part of this opportunity?The Telecommunications landscape is in a constant flux of change. For telecommunication professionals, knowledge and competence is vital in this ever-changing industry.At Huawei we are...


  • Bucharest, Bucureşti, Romania Criteo Full time

    What if, in your next adventure, you were surrounded by people who, like you, look for an unlimited playground to explore, share, and test, would you care to hear more? You've opened the right door As an R&D team, making sure your ideas are heard and encouraged is what we strive to doWhat You'll Do: Lead a team of 3 to 5 software developers, whom you will...


  • Bucharest, Bucureşti, Romania Criteo Full time

    What if, in your next adventure, you were surrounded by people who, like you, look for an unlimited playground to explore, share, and test, would you care to hear more? You've opened the right door As an R&D team, making sure your ideas are heard and encouraged is what we strive to doWhat You'll Do:The concept of Product Reliability Engineering (PRE) draws...

  • Senior C++ Engineer

    1 month ago


    Bucharest, Bucureşti, Romania N-iX Full time

    We are looking for a talented and experienced Senior C++ Engineer to join our innovative team for part-time engagement (minimum 4 hours per day) for 5.5 months. Our project aims to transform traffic management technology through a cutting-edge platform that utilizes advanced sensor fusion to manage complex junction scenarios. If you are passionate about...


  • Bucharest, Bucureşti, Romania Adobe Full time

    Senior Machine Learning Engineer Senior Machine Learning Engineer The CC Services Romania engineering team is seeking a highly skilled Senior Machine Learning Engineer to join our team and create innovative experiences for Creative Cloud clients. About the Role Set technical and research direction, making architectural decisions, and implementing...


  • Bucharest, Bucureşti, Romania Luxoft Full time

    Project descriptionThe client's proprietary software solution simplifies the management and use of distributed clusters for Artificial Intelligence (AI) and High-Performance Computing (HPC) environments.ResponsibilitiesWe are looking for Software Engineers to design and implement LiCO new systems and features, as well as modify and maintain existing systems...